数据库是存储和管理数据的工具,近年来随着数据的爆炸式增长,数据库的需求也越来越大。作为初学者,我们需要学习数据库的相关知识和使用方法。本文从数据库的定义、类型、功能、应用以及学习的建议等方面分析数据库菜鸟教程。
一、数据库的定义和类型
数据库是指存放在计算机中、有组织、可以共享的大量数据的集合。它包含数据、数据管理系统和数据库管理系统三个部分,而数据库则可以分为关系型数据库、非关系型数据库和分布式数据库等几种类型。
1.关系型数据库
关系型数据库是目前应用最为广泛的一类数据库,其最大特点就是采用关系模型进行数据的组织和管理。例如Oracle、MySQL、SQL Server等都是关系型数据库。
2.非关系型数据库
非关系型数据库则没有采用传统的关系模型,使用的是NoSQL模型。非关系型数据库常见的有MongoDB、Redis、Cassandra等。
3.分布式数据库
分布式数据库是指将数据分散在不同的计算机或服务器上,通过网络实现数据的远程访问和共享。例如Hadoop、Hbase等都是分布式数据库。
二、数据库的功能和应用
1.数据管理
数据库的首要功能就是进行数据的管理,包括数据的存储、查询、修改和删除等。可以利用数据库对数据进行高效统一管理。
2.数据安全
数据库还可以提供数据的安全保障,包括数据的备份、恢复和加密等。通过其内置的安全机制,确保数据库中的数据不会被非法获取或修改。
3.数据分析
数据库中的数据可以进行统计和分析,从而为数据的处理提供科学依据。可以用于数据挖掘、商业智能、大数据分析等方面。
4.应用范围
数据库已经成为各行各业必不可少的一个组成部分。教育、医疗、银行、电商、物流等行业都需要数据库来进行数据管理和分析,提高工作效率和信息化水平。
三、如何学习数据库
1.掌握基础知识
学习数据库需要具备一定的计算机基础,如操作系统、计算机网络、数据结构等。还需了解SQL语言和常用的数据库管理系统。
2.实践操作
除了纸上谈兵,实践操作也是非常重要的。可以使用Oracle、MySQL等常见数据库进行实操练习和体验,从而增强对数据库的理解。
3.参考教材
网络上有很多数据库入门教程和视频课程,可以供学习者参考。其中常见的网站如菜鸟教程、慕课网等,在学完理论知识后也可以进行相关课程的学习。
4.参与项目
最好的学习方法就是实践,通过参与项目可以更深入地理解数据库应用。在实际项目中操作数据库,不断学习和提高。
扫码咨询 领取资料